Job Description:

We are seeking a detail-oriented and technically strong accounting professional to support the Company’s SEC reporting, technical accounting, quarterly and annual close, and external audit processes. This role will play an important part in preparing accurate and timely financial statements, disclosures, and SEC filings while partnering closely with Finance, Legal, Tax, Treasury, FP&A, Investor Relations, and other cross-functional teams. The ideal candidate will bring strong knowledge of U.S. GAAP, excellent analytical and organizational skills, and a commitment to maintaining high-quality reporting, controls, and continuous process improvement.

Key Responsibilities

SEC & External Reporting

  • Assist with the preparation and filing of quarterly and annual SEC reports, including Forms 10-Q and 10-K.

  • Prepare and update financial statements, footnotes, and other disclosures in accordance with U.S. GAAP and SEC reporting requirements.

  • Support preparation of other SEC filings, including Forms 8-K and registration statements, as applicable.

  • Support preparation of quarterly earnings materials (e.g. earning press release, shareholder letter, etc.) and other external financial information, as needed.

  • Prepare supporting schedules, tie-outs, disclosure checklists, and other documentation supporting SEC filings.

  • Perform detailed tie-outs of financial statements and disclosures to the underlying general ledger, consolidation system, and supporting documentation.

  • Maintain appropriate documentation and audit trails supporting reported amounts and disclosures.

  • Assist with XBRL tagging and review, including coordination with external service providers.

  • Monitor filing requirements and support the SEC reporting calendar to ensure all deadlines are met.

Technical Accounting

  • Research U.S. GAAP and SEC reporting requirements and document accounting conclusions as needed.

  • Assist with the implementation of new accounting standards and related financial statement disclosures.

  • Support technical accounting analyses involving areas such as: Business combinations, Stock-based compensation, Earnings per share, Equity transactions, and Investments and joint ventures.

  • Monitor new accounting pronouncements and SEC developments and assess their potential impact on the Company's financial statements and disclosures.

  • Benchmark financial statement disclosures against peer companies and SEC reporting practices.

Quarterly and Annual Close

  • Support the quarterly and annual financial close process and ensure information required for external reporting is complete and accurate.

  • Prepare and review financial statement supporting schedules.

  • Investigate unusual fluctuations and coordinate with relevant accounting and finance teams to resolve reporting issues.

Audit & Cross-Functional Coordination

  • Serve as a key point of contact for external auditors on SEC reporting and financial statement disclosure matters.

  • Prepare audit support and respond to auditor requests related to financial statements, footnotes, and supporting schedules.

  • Coordinate with Legal, Tax, Treasury, FP&A, Investor Relations, Stock Administration, and other functions to gather and validate information for external reporting.

  • Support management review, Disclosure Committee, and Audit Committee reporting processes.

Internal Controls & Process Improvement

  • Perform control activities in accordance with established SOX controls.

  • Maintain documentation supporting key financial reporting controls.

  • Identify opportunities to improve reporting processes, controls, and efficiency.

  • Assist with automation and standardization of financial reporting schedules and workpapers.

  • Support improvements to reporting systems, consolidation processes, and financial data workflows.

Qualifications

Required

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field

    or equivalent relevant professional experience.

  • Min of five years of relevant accounting or financial reporting experience.

  • Strong knowledge of U.S. GAAP and financial statement presentation.

  • Experience with quarterly and annual financial reporting processes.

  • Strong Microsoft Excel skills.

  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ities.

  • Strong attention to detail with the ability to produce accurate work under tight deadlines.

  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.

  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and work effectively across functional teams.

Preferred

  • CPA or progress toward CPA certification.

  • Public accounting experience, preferably with a Big Four or national accounting firm.

  • SEC reporting experience with a publicly traded company.

  • Experience preparing or reviewing Forms 10-K and 10-Q.

  • Familiarity with SEC reporting and XBRL platforms such as Workiva.

  • Experience with ERP and consolidation systems such as NetSuite, Oracle, or similar platforms.

  • Experience researching accounting guidance using the FASB Accounting Standards Codification and SEC rules and regulations.

Key Competencies

  • High level of accuracy and attention to detail

  • Strong technical accounting foundation

  • Ownership and accountability

  • Ability to work effectively under quarterly and annual reporting deadlines

  • Strong organizational and project-management skills

  • Effective cross-functional communication

  • Ability to research and resolve accounting and reporting issues independently

  • Continuous-improvement mindset

Career Development

This position provides broad exposure to SEC reporting, technical accounting, external audit, senior finance leadership, and cross-functional business teams. The role is well suited for an accounting professional seeking to develop deeper expertise in public-company reporting and progress toward Senior Accountant and Accounting Manager-level responsibilities.
